Joe has a summer job mowing lawns for his neighbors. He is saving the money he earns to buy a new bike. Joe earned $45.50 on Monday mowing lawns. On Tuesday he earned $35.75 and on Wednesday he earned $25.25. He needs $167.99 to buy the bike he wants. How much more money does Joe need to earn in order to buy the bike?

$106.50

$61.49

$122.49

$274.49
